The Windows X-Lite - Micro 11 24H2 V3 -FBConan-.7z is a customized, lightweight version of the Windows 11 operating system. The nomenclature suggests a few key points: "X-Lite" indicates a focus on minimalism and efficiency, "Micro 11" signifies that it's based on Windows 11, and "24H2" refers to a specific build or version number. The "-FBConan-" part likely denotes the creator or a specific variant of this build, while ".7z" indicates that the file is compressed in 7-Zip format, a common choice for distributing software packages. --- -Windows X-Lite- Micro 11 24H2 V3 -FBConan-.7z
